










New Lexicons For Embodiment
Bárbara Sánchez-Kane
“What happens,” asks Luis Felipe Fabre, “to the body dressed in Sánchez-Kane?” Its limbs mutate. Its organs swell. It sprouts an ear where once was an arm. The body becomes monstrous, vampiric. Its identity is slurred. Its image stripped. It disappears. New Lexicons for Embodiment celebrates Bárbara Sánchez-Kane’s (1987, Mérida, Mexico) eponymous sartorio-sculptural exhibition at Kurimanzutto, New York, from Sept. 14 through Oct. 21, 2023.
